Warranty Question
Question for anyone who has purchased a New Harley from a dealership.
I want to do simple stage 1 upgrades on my '09 FXD.
Just Screaming Eagle Air cleaner And Slip on mufflers.
Reading The information from H-D I gather that unless you have these upgrades installed by the dealer they will void your warranty.
Sounds really chicken**** to me and I think Ca. Law requires them to prove how your upgrades caused whatever failure is involved.
But I would like to hear from any rider that has had problems with dealer claims of no coverage.
I've paid for the extra 5 years of warranty and don't want to get screwed.

I sent this Email to the dealer I purchased my Dyna from.
I would like to install a Screaming Eagle air cleaner and Screaming Eagle slip on mufflers on the SuperGlide I purchased from you.Because I am on a fixed Income I would prefer to do the labor myself. These are simple upgrades that don't require a degree in rocket science to perform. I would of course have the EFI ECM remapped to adjust to these changes. That may or may not be done at your dealership depending on the labor quote I receive from you and competing shops.The question I have is, should I experience an engine or other failure other than the Air cleaner or exhaust, Do you stand behind the Warranty?A simple answer without a lot of ifs, ands, buts and ors will help.
This is the reply I recieved.
We cannot warranty work that we have not done. (I thought I was clear that I didn't expect them to do that.) If you purchase the items over the counter to install yourself they have a 90 day warranty on defective merchandise only. We stand behind the factory warranty 100% as long as the problem was not caused by aftermarket parts or work done by anyone other than factory authorized dealers. I hope this answers your questions.
Now I understand that to mean they will honor the warranty even if I do my own installation of the upgrades.
